Synopsis "The Scouts Of Stonewall The Story Of The Great Valley Campaign"

"The Scouts of Stonewall" is a novel by Joseph A. Altsheler set during the American Civil War. The story follows Harry Kenton, a young officer on the staff of Colonel Talbot, commander of the Invincibles, a South Carolina regiment that has been transferred to the command of Stonewall Jackson in the Shenandoah Valley. Despite suffering losses in previous battles, the Invincibles remain devoted to the Southern cause and long for action. Harry is frequently sent on scouting missions due to his skill in the forest and field. Despite the peacefulness of the forest, Harry knows that danger is ever-present as he rides to discover the enemy's plans and location. As the novel progresses, the story develops into a tale of adventure, battle, and bravery as the Invincibles join forces with Stonewall Jackson to fight against the Union forces in the Shenandoah Valley.
